Scott McTominay's impressive performances for Napoli have caught the attention of fans and pundits alike. Since joining the Italian club from Manchester United last summer for around £25 million, the 28-year-old Scottish midfielder has been a standout player for Antonio Conte's side.

Key Factors Behind McTominay's Success
- *Versatility*: McTominay has demonstrated his ability to score goals with both feet and his head, a rare feat in Serie A this season. He recently became the only Napoli player to achieve this, netting a towering header in a 1-1 draw against Udinese.
- *Tactical Importance*: Napoli boss Antonio Conte praises McTominay's goalscoring ability, saying he "has goals in his blood" and is "very good at moving forward, has technique as well as height and physicality".
- *Adaptability*: McTominay has seamlessly adapted to Conte's tactics, allowing the team to transform into a 4-3-3 formation. His performances have earned him praise from Italian media, with outlets like La Gazzetta dello Sport and Corriere dello Sport highlighting his "crazy energy" and "incredible impact on the Italian league".
- *Dietary Monitoring*: Despite his success on the pitch, McTominay is being closely monitored by Napoli's nutritionist, Tiberio Ancora, to ensure he maintains a balanced diet and avoids excessive dairy consumption.

Impact on Napoli's Performance
McTominay's contributions have been instrumental in Napoli's strong start to the season. The team sits top of Serie A, four points ahead of Inter Milan, with Conte emphasizing the importance of his players' performances ¹ ² ³.
